2. Oppenheimer

The story of American scientist J. Robert Oppenheimer and his role in the development of the atomic bomb.
  • Genre: Biography, Drama, History
  • Director(s): Christopher Nolan
  • Writer(s): Christopher Nolan, Kai Bird, Martin Sherwin
  • Actors(s): Cillian Murphy, Emily Blunt, Matt Damon
  • Runtime: 180 min
  • Total gross to date: $10,891,486.00
  • Weekend gross: $10,891,486.00
  • Number of cinemas: 667
  • Site average: $16,329.00
  • Country of origin: USA
  • Distributor: Universal
  • Change from last week: -
  • Weeks on release: 1
    Ratings:
  • Internet Movie Database: 8.8/10
  • Metacritic: 89/100

3. Mission: Impossible - Dead Reckoning Part One

Ethan Hunt and his IMF team must track down a dangerous weapon before it falls into the wrong hands.
  • Genre: Action, Adventure, Thriller
  • Director(s): Christopher McQuarrie
  • Writer(s): Bruce Geller, Erik Jendresen, Christopher McQuarrie
  • Actors(s): Tom Cruise, Hayley Atwell, Ving Rhames
  • Runtime: 163 min
  • Total gross to date: $16,434,929.00
  • Weekend gross: $2,891,093.00
  • Number of cinemas: 696
  • Site average: $4,154.00
  • Country of origin: UK/USA
  • Distributor: Paramount
  • Change from last week: -72
  • Weeks on release: 2
    Ratings:
  • Internet Movie Database: 8.1/10
  • Metacritic: 81/100
